AdultEdWe at St. Thomas have a vision to be a church where anyone can find a small groups to welcome them and where they can fit.  These groups may vary in focus but each is very intentional and committed to provide opportunities for relationship, discipleship, and evangelism.  Our mission:  To promote healthy relationships through small groups which empower people for ministry in Jesus Christ.

 

 

Four factors we recognize about small groups are:

People want to be in a group with other people they enjoy being around.
People want to focus on things in which they have an interest.
People want a way to leave a group without hurting the feelings of the others in the group.
People don’t want their group to be arbitrarily split if it is too successful.

Our small groups have starting and stopping times.  Click “What’s of interest for adults?” for a listing of current groups.
